What do sugar and addictive drugs have in common?
A) They create states of euphoria in high doses.
B) They stimulate activity in the hypothalamus.
C) They inhibit self-control by inhibiting the cingulate gyrus.
D) They stimulate dopamine release in the nucleus accumbens.
Answer: D
Rationale: Sucrose can stimulate the release of dopamine in the nucleus accumbens, a brain region associated with the reinforcing effects of substances such as amphetamines and cocaine.
